AS Roma Fans Chant Racist Abuse Against Two AC Milan Players At The Stadio Olimpico

The duo silenced the fans at the end of the game by taking all three points but action is necessary against the club and those fans.

AC Milan played at the Stadio Olimpico last night and beat AS Roma 2-1 to shatter the home unbeaten run. Two Milan players were the subject of racist abuse from the Roma fans and both those players happened to score to bury Jose Mourinho’s side.

Guillaume MP reported that Milan’s striker Zlatan Ibrahimovic received jeers after his goal but the Roma fans had been chanting “Sei uno zingaro” which translates to “You are a gypsy” at the 40 year old. The Swede scored a lovely free kick and gestured at the crowd to raise their voices even more which got him booked by referee Maresca for ‘provocation.’

MilanNews.it are reporting that Franck Kessie also received racist abuse from the Roma fans in the second half when he committed a foul and received a yellow card. The fans directed monkey chants at the Ivory Coast international.

It remains to be seen if the disciplinary action is taken against the club and it’s fans as this has been an issue seen in multiple games this season already.
